Lift and Tire Question

I have a 99 f-150 supercab would like to upgrade and add a 3'' body lift with 305's. Already have bfg 285's on 16x8 eagle 143's. Does anybody have this combo our a similar one. Would like to have some imput on how it looks my truck looks pretty good as is with the set up I got now, but always like going bigger.

99 ORP with 305/70/16 Pro Comp M/T's and 16" Atlas wheel. Suspension is factory. You don't really need a body lift unless you have a 4x2. Hope this helps.

teamtrent,do you have any tire rub? is your torison bars cranked?

No, its all factory for now. No twist on the bars. I did trim about 1/4" off of the front valance (used a pair of tin snips). Truck turns fine from lock to lock. The only tires I have heard of rubbing is the tires with large side lugs. The ProComp M/T's are meaty but sit the same under the truck as my AT/S tires. 305's will fit under most trucks with minimal rubbing if any. I was just thinking that us Ford guys have it nice since we don't have to lift the body 3" and expose a huge section of the frame rails to fit 33" tires like the Z71's.
